Transaction 286242149a99af87c29537c1923675b43c9e85ecdc2a082ba5aef2a51925e393
1 Input
1 Output
-
286242149a99af87c29537c1923675b43c9e85ecdc2a082ba5aef2a51925e393:0
- value
- 20796
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a1c705b123a07a086bf45d1cee066adcbd0156ffd4fdf86aafc6a5db77a7f95f
- address
- bc1p58rstvfr5paqs6l5t5wwupn2mj7sz4hl6n7ls640c6jakaa8l90st4zs39